Output 213417605dfe3845f97a79e890744a3430aaa4e1dadcf759cf012ec9fb20bcaa:0

value
56646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77ce07c4636f7daf9d6574bf124cb7c35d825da2 OP_EQUAL
address
3CcV9cNGeMVJNHP98TV2SApyh5fJqLnQgC
transaction
213417605dfe3845f97a79e890744a3430aaa4e1dadcf759cf012ec9fb20bcaa
confirmations
111059
spent
true